Broadband prices are coming down all the time and are a fraction of what it used to cost to send files abroad by modem

Email means no phone bill

Electricity - we use less and less due to more energy-efficient hardware and lighting (plus we have solar panels)

Heating - we grow our own wood (admittedly not an option for all translators!)

Accountancy - the same (partly because everything is computerised instead of on paper)

Paper - big screens mean we print a lot less

Stamps - forgotten what they are

Fax paper - so 20th century

What else is there?
